Mybatis jdbctype other
WebApr 14, 2024 · configuration.jdbc-type-for-null :控制 Mybatis 如何处理 null 值,可选值为 NULL、VARCHAR、OTHER(默认为 NULL)。 configuration.log-impl :指定 Mybatis 使用的日志框架,默认为 Log4j2。 configuration.wrap-result-maps :控制 Mybatis 是否对结果集进行包装,默认为 false。 configuration.default-statement-type :设置默认的语句类 … WebMay 26, 2024 · MyBatis is an open source persistence framework which simplifies the implementation of database access in Java applications. It provides the support for custom SQL, stored procedures and different types of mapping relations. Simply put, it's an alternative to JDBC and Hibernate. 2. Maven Dependencies
Mybatis jdbctype other
Did you know?
WebJdbcType : OTHER : JdbcType : REAL : JdbcType : REF : JdbcType : ROWID : JdbcType : SMALLINT : JdbcType : SQLXML : JdbcType : STRUCT : JdbcType : TIME : JdbcType : … WebJul 17, 2024 · Having the mybatis.type-handlers-package defined in Spring Boot application.properties (or yaml), forces you to have to declare the type of id (in this case) …
WebJan 6, 2011 · Types.OTHER works for some JDBC drivers, but it breaks many others such as Oracle 10g and later, causing MyBatis to throw the exception "Error setting null parameter. … WebApr 15, 2024 · 可以看出,是因为你传入的参数的字段为null对象无法获取对应的jdbcType类型,而报的错误。 你只要在insert语句中insert的对象加上jdbcType就可以了,修改如 …
WebApr 9, 2024 · MyBatis 通过包含的jdbcType类型 BIT FLOAT CHAR TIMESTAMP OTHER UNDEFINED TINYINT REAL VARCHAR BINARY BLOB NVARCHAR SMALLINT DOUBLE LONGVARCHAR VARBINARY CLOB NCHAR INTEGER NUMERIC DATE LONGVARBINARY BOOLEAN NCLOB BIGINT DECIMAL TIME NULL CURSOR Mybatis中javaType和jdbcType … Web#基本TypeHandle 我们知道Mybatis默认可以将数据库的一些数据类型映射为JAVA的数据类型,这是通过TypeHandles ... OTHER 或未指定类型 ... 对象 * @param i 当前参数位置 * …
WebMar 23, 2024 · 总结. 本文介绍了Mybatis的高级特性,包括动态SQL的优化技巧、缓存机制、插件机制和自定义类型转换。动态SQL的优化技巧包括使用标签生成WHERE语句、使用标签批量操作时尽量使用batch模式等。缓存机制包括一级缓存和二级缓存,可以通过配置文件进行开启或关闭。
WebTry setting a different JdbcType for this parameter or a different configuration property. Cause: org.apache.ibatis.type.TypeException: Error setting non null for parameter #3 with JdbcType VARCHAR . Try setting a different JdbcType for this parameter or a different configuration property. kia walk ins for serviceWeb如果是增删改的时候,需要加上typeHandler和jdbcType,这里用的是mybatis-plus的JacksonTypeHandler,比如 ... MyBatis 的强大特性之一便是它的动态 SQL。如果你有使用 JDBC 或其它类似框架的经验,你就能体会到根据不同条件拼接 SQL 语句的痛苦。 kia wallace stuart flWebMyBatis therefore uses the combination javaType= [TheJavaType], jdbcType=null to choose a TypeHandler. This means that using a @MappedJdbcTypes annotation restricts the … is malpighia glabra toxic to dogsWebApr 15, 2024 · Mybatis中的jdbcType的作用 MyBatis 插入空值时,需要指定JdbcType ,如mybatis insert空值报空值异常,但是在pl/sql不会提示错误,主要原因是mybatis无法进行转换。 可以看出,是因为你传入的参数的字段为null对象无法获取对应的jdbcType类型,而报的错误。 你只要在insert语句中insert的对象加上jdbcType就可以了,修改如下: # … is malpractice insurance the same as e\u0026oWebFrom the MyBatis documentation: The JDBC type is only required for nullable columns upon insert, update or delete. This is a JDBC requirement, not a MyBatis one. So even if you … kia wallingford ctWebApr 14, 2024 · Try setting a different jdbctype for this parameter or a different JDBC typefornull configuration property. Cause: java.sql.sqlexception: invalid column type If there is an exception, trace it to mybatis. To avoid verbosity, just use ojdbc6 for debugging, because ojbc6 is more stable with the latest version of mybatis. kia waldorf md service hoursWebpublic static JdbcType[] values() Returns an array containing the constants of this enum type, in the order they are declared. This method may be used to iterate over the … kiawambogo secondary school